S SHAWMUT RD in Golden Valley, Montana is rated Fair in the FHWA's 2024 National Bridge Inventory. Built in 1964, it carries 3 rated components on the inspecting agency's 0-9 scale, and its weakest reported component scores 5. The lowest applicable rating sets the federal condition category, so this Fair result describes the weakest reported component rather than the structure as a whole. Bridge Snapshot: S SHAWMUT RD

The S SHAWMUT RD bridge in Golden Valley, Montana carries S SHAWMUT RD over FISH CREEK 002. It was built in 1964, making it 62 years old today. The structure is built primarily of wood or timber and spans 2 sections, stretching 11.7 meters (38 feet) end to end. Daily traffic averages 100 vehicles, placing it in the lower-traffic tier of Montana bridges. It is owned and maintained by County Highway Agency.

The latest FHWA inspection records show a deck rating of 6/9, superstructure at 6/9, substructure at 5/9. The weakest component sits in fair condition. None of this bridge's reported major components fall into the Poor condition range.
